An excellent opportunity has arisen for a Litigation/Dispute Resolution Solicitor to join a highly regarded Legal 500 practice in Stoke-on-Trent. This is a full-time, permanent position offering high-quality work, hybrid working, clear career progression and an exceptional work/life balance.
Our client is a well-established firm with multiple offices and an outstanding reputation for delivering the calibre of work typically associated with larger national practices. The firm is committed to investing in its people, offering twice-yearly appraisals, structured career development and clear guidance on progression to the next stage of your career.
The Dispute Resolution team is entering an exciting growth phase and currently includes a Partner, an Associate, a Solicitor, a trainee and a paralegal. Due to continued expansion, the firm is seeking an ambitious Solicitor with at least 5 years' PQE to strengthen the team.
The Role
You will handle a broad range of commercial and property litigation matters, acting predominantly for SMEs. The ideal candidate will have experience advising on:
- Commercial litigation
- Property litigation
- Breach of contract disputes
- Professional negligence claims
- Shareholder disputes
- Landlord and tenant matters
- Breach of statutory and fiduciary duties, including director and trustee disputes
Experience in insolvency litigation, contentious probate, or construction disputes would be advantageous but is by no means essential.
The Firm
The firm operates realistic chargeable hours target, with a genuine focus on encouragement rather than pressure. Employee wellbeing is a key priority and the firm prides itself on fostering a supportive culture where work/life balance is genuinely valued.
